NOVELTY - Graphene laminate (I) comprises: a substrate (10); a binder layer (20) on the substrate; and graphene (30) on the binder layer, where the graphene is bound to the substrate by the binder layer. USE - (I) is useful in a transparent electrode and an electrical device (all claimed) such as a super-capacitor, a fuel cell, and solar cell. (I) is useful: to form a flexible structure; in various display devices such as a field emission display, a liquid crystal display, an organic light emitting device; in various nano-devices, such as a field-effect transistor and a memory device; and in a hydrogen storage device, an optical fiber and another electric device. ADVANTAGE - (I) is in large-size and has fewer defects.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is included for preparing (I) comprising forming graphene on a graphitization catalyst film, coating a surface of a substrate with a binder layer composition, contacting the binder layer composition and the graphene, curing the binder layer composition to form a binder layer, and removing the graphitization catalyst film to prepare (I).
